CPV Research & Development / Science

Search results for "". Page 1 of 1, Results 1 to 1 of 1
Title Job Function Location Date Sort descending
Reset
RESEARCH & DEVELOPMENT STAFF
RESEARCH & DEVELOPMENT STAFF Research & Development / Science VN 19 Apr 2024
Research & Development / Science VN 19 Apr 2024